& Initial Damage Assessment Initially, guarantee everyone is risk-free. Look for downed high-voltage line, gas smells, or architectural instability; if you believe any of these, evacuate and call emergency solutions. Take photos and video clip from a risk-free range– these documents are indispensable for insurance claims. Keep in mind roofing system debris, missing out on shingles, harmed seamless gutters, split house siding, busted home windows, and water intrusion inside ceilings or walls. Develop a straightforward list room by room; prioritize leakages, subjected structural elements, and threats that might get worse in the following storm.Emergency Short-term Fixes to Stop More Injury If water is entering your home, usage pails and

towels to contain it and relocate prized possessions out of damage’s method. Cover roofing system holes or exposed locations with durable tarpaulins protected with roof covering nails or screws with timber battens– stay clear of walking on a harmed roofing if you are unclear. For damaged home windows, board them with plywood cut to dimension and secured to the framework. Seal small house siding voids with exterior-grade caulk. Short-lived repairs keep damage from escalating while you organize professional repairs and insurance policy inspections.Shingles and Roof covering Repair work: Repair Work vs. Change When it involves tiles, the crucial question is extent. Change a few missing out on or broken roof shingles if the outdoor decking and underlayment are intact;

patching is cost-efficient and quick. However

, if big swaths are blown off, granule loss is extreme, or the underlayment reveals moisture, a complete substitute may be much safer in the long run. Request for a written assessment from a qualified roofing professional that plainly discusses continuing to be life expectancy, warranty implications, and approximated costs for both fixing and substitute options.Siding, Windows, and Outside Remediation Techniques Home siding can typically be repaired by replacing harmed panels, re-fastening loosened sections, and resealing joints. Plastic and fiber concrete have various fixing demands; match materials and paint
for a seamless appearance. For home windows, prioritize weatherproofing and architectural stability– change fractured panes, repair structures, and set up new flashing where required. Bring back rain gutters and downspouts to make sure proper water drainage; clogged or damaged systems contribute to water breach and structure issues.Navigating Insurance coverage, Contractors, and Future Avoidance Paper everything and call your insurer without delay. Recognize your policy’s wind damage protection, deductibles, and insurance claim deadlines. Get numerous professional proposals and verify licenses, insurance coverage, and recommendations. Stay clear of storm-chasing specialists with high-pressure tactics. Ultimately, minimize future threat by cutting at risk trees, enhancing roofing system edges, mounting impact-resistant home windows, and maintaining gutters clear.
